Step1: Recall the formula for the axis of symmetry of a parabola
For a parabola \(y = ax^{2}+bx + c\), the axis of symmetry is \(x=-\frac{b}{2a}\). Another way is to find the mid - point of the roots. If the roots of the quadratic function (where \(y = 0\)) are \(x_1\) and \(x_2\), then the axis of symmetry is \(x=\frac{x_1 + x_2}{2}\).
